사용자 Azure AD 활동 작성

  • 릴리스 버전: Xanadu
  • 업데이트 날짜 2024년 08월 01일
  • 읽기3분
  • 사용자 만들기 작업은 Azure Active Directory 테넌트에 대한 사용자를 만듭니다.

    워크플로우 편집기에서 이 활동에 액세스하려면 사용자 지정 탭을 선택한 후 사용자 지정 활동 > Azure AD. 이 활동은 REST 웹 서비스 활동 템플릿을 사용하여 빌드되었습니다.

    중요사항:
    이 활동에 사용되는 REST 메시지는 OAuth 2.0을 사용하도록 구성되어야 합니다.

    입력 변수

    표 1. 사용자 입력 변수 생성
    변수 설명
    display_name 허용되는 표시 형식의 Azure AD 사용자 이름입니다(예: jacinto.gawron).
    user_principal_name 전자 메일 형식의 UPN(사용자 계정 이름)입니다. 예를 들어 jacinto.gawron@khitomer.com 를 입력할 수 있습니다.
    mail_nickname 사용자의 전체 주소로 리디렉션되는 사용자의 이메일 별칭입니다.
    암호 사용자의 Azure AD 암호입니다. 이 암호는 암호 유형(2단계 암호화) 을 사용하여 워크플로 입력으로 전달되어야 하며 Azure AD에 설정된 암호 정책을 충족해야 합니다.
    change_password true로 설정된 경우 다음 로그인 시 사용자가 암호를 변경해야 하는 제어입니다.
    account_enabled true로 설정된 경우 사용자의 계정을 설정하는 컨트롤이 활성화됩니다.
    given_name 사용자의 이름입니다.
    사용자의 성입니다.
    other_mails 사용자의 추가 이메일 주소 목록입니다. 예를 들어 ["jac@home.com", "jgawron@fabrikam.com"]를 입력할 수 있습니다.
    국가 사용자가 소재한 국가 또는 지역. 예를 들어 미국 또는 영국을 입력할 수 있습니다. 기본값은US로 설정됩니다.
    구/군/시 사용자가 소재하는 도시.
    부서 사용자가 근무하는 부서의 이름입니다.
    모바일 사용자의 기본 휴대 전화 번호입니다.
    job_title 사용자의 직함입니다.
    physical_delivery_office_name 사용자 비즈니스 위치의 사무실 위치입니다.
    postal_code 사용자 주소의 우편 번호입니다.
    preferred_language 사용자가 의사 소통을 선호하는 언어입니다. 이 값은 ISO 639-1 코드를 따라야 합니다. 예를 들어 en-US를 입력할 수 있습니다. 기본값은 en-US로 설정됩니다.
    상태 사용자 주소의 시 또는 도입니다.
    street_address 사용자 사업장의 도로명 주소입니다.
    telephone_number 사용자 사업장의 기본 전화 번호입니다.
    usage_location Office 365 라이선스가 할당된 사용자에게 필요한 두 글자 국가 코드입니다. 기본값은 US입니다.

    출력 변수

    표 2. 사용자 출력 변수 생성
    변수 설명
    오류 REST 메시지에서 오류 문자열을 반환합니다. 오류가 없는 경우 이 변수는 null 값을 반환합니다.
    status_code 웹 서비스에서 반환된 상태 코드를 포함합니다.
    user_exists 사용자가 이미 있음 오류가 포함된 JSON 메시지에 매핑된 출력 변수입니다.
    user_info 배열에는 user_info 다른 활동에서 입력으로 활용할 수 있는 속성이 포함되어 있습니다. 예를 들어 사용자 objectid 출력(GUID)을 그룹에 사용자 추가 작업에 입력으로 user_id 전달할 수 있습니다.
    • objectid: 사용자의 Azure AD 식별자입니다.
    • accountEnabled: 사용자의 계정이 활성 상태인지 또는 비활성 상태인지를 나타내는 부울 변수입니다.
    • displayName: 사용자 표시 이름(예: jacinto.gawron)입니다.
    • userPrincipalName: jacinto.gawron@wammo.com 와 같은 이메일 형식의 사용자 이름입니다.
    • mailNickname: 사용자의 이메일 별칭입니다.

    조건

    표 3. 사용자 조건 생성
    조건 설명
    생성한 사용자 활동에서 사용자를 작성했습니다.
    사용자가 이미 존재함 사용자가 테넌트 도메인에 이미 있습니다.
    실패 활동이 Azure AD에 연결하지 못했거나 입력 값이 잘못되었습니다.